Definition of interstitial tissue -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
medicalTECH. tissue found between other tissues or organsTECH.
- Interstitial tissue provides support and structure to organs..
- The interstitial tissue was inflamed due to the infection.
- Researchers are studying the role of interstitial tissue in disease.
